India’s PC market ships 3.4 million units in Q2 of 2019: IDC

India’s Personal Computer market (including desktop, notebook and workstation) shipped 3.4 million units in the second quarter (Q2) of 2019, a 49.2 per cent year-on-year (YoY) rise. Lenovo led the market, while HP slipped to second spot and Dell came in third, according to an International Data Corporation (IDC) report.

According to a statement, the growth was mainly due to the commercial segment driven by the fulfilment of the education deal by the Electronics Corporation of Tamil Nadu Ltd (ELCOT). As per the deal, the Tamil Nadu Government plans to distribute about 1.5 million laptops to students.

Lenovo led India’s traditional PC market in Q2 of 2019 with an overall market share of 46.2 per cent, even though the vendor witnessed a 14 per cent YoY fall in the consumer segment.
